I will start by saying I have no direct or even indirect connection to either chiropractors or acupuncturists or a health related industry. I have no axe to grind.

I am also criticized by my wife for being a skeptic of everything. I am a big believer in science and the scientific method. I would also like to think I have a strong testimony of the restored gospel. I say this to give perspective for this anecdote.

On my mission I had a terrible bout of stomach sickness with accompanied headache and neck pain. I was very uncomfortable. It lasted some time. We had an acupuncturist member of the church who desperately wanted to help and I was 19 at the time and maybe not weighing all consequences and willing to give it a try. I like to experience things first hand and was always skeptical of needles being poked at strategic points could possibly be anything more than a placebo effect. How could parasites die or damage be corrected with a few strategically placed needles. I figured it was pure garbage and unlikely to do harm (not completely thinking through the sanitary part of the needles, although he appeared to clean his tools in my presence with alcohol etc). I had zero expectations it would work or do much of anything.

Say what you will, but it certainly worked on me. The moment one needle hit between my thump and finger on the wide part of my hand I felt a minor jolt down my arm and my headache was gone. Not slightly, not slowly... it was gone, instantly. It did not return. I had no other side effects.

Then he placed some other needles and my stomach issues improved within a very short time. I have no idea how it could limit my continual trips to the bathroom, but it did. I still had some things to evacuate, but it stopped the continual trips and overall feeling of overwhelming fatigue and sickness. I was certainly not jumping to my feet, but I felt a lot better and improved quickly. I did not relapse at all. I just improved quickly and was better.

I have no idea how it all works, and admit it can go too far but it most certainly worked on me.
